Eventually everyone makes a Lord of the Rings Book Nook, so here's my version inspired by The Hobbit, complete with a custom sculpted Smaug and Bilbo!

Materials Used:
Super Sculpey (medium and firm)
Fimo Professional (coloured)
Mod podge (gloss and matt)
Vallejo Paints (Game Colour)
XPS Foam
Packing Foam (random assorted of stuff I had lying about)
Vinyl Flooring
Spackle
Glitter
Flameless LED t-lights
UV Resin
